1. Examining Your Space and Dimensions
Before browsing functions, you need to understand your spatial constraints. Nothing is more frustrating than having a brand-new fridge provided just to find that it obstructs a doorway or won't fit through the front door.
- Measure the Aperture: Measure the width, height, and depth of the area where the Fridge Reviews will live.
- Represent Clearance: Leave a minimum of an inch of space on all sides for air blood circulation and ensure the doors can completely open without hitting islands or walls.
- The Path of Travel: Measure the width of your hallways and doorways leading into the cooking area to ensure the home appliance can actually enter into the room.

Necessary Features to Look For
Modern refrigerators come with buy a fridge dizzying selection of tech, but concentrating on practical functions will yield the very best return on investment.
- Smart Connectivity: Allows you to track grocery lists, see temperatures, or receive informs if a door is left open.
- Dual Cooling Systems: Separates the air flow in between the fridge and the freezer, which keeps the fridge damp (keeps produce fresh) and the freezer dry (prevents freezer burn).
- Water and Ice Dispensers: Extremely convenient, but keep in mind that internal dispensers save area, while external dispensers are much easier to use however prone to leaking and hardware failure.
- Adjustable Shelving: Look for spill-proof glass shelves and cantilevered designs that can be relocated to accommodate tall products like white wine bottles or water pitchers.
4. Energy Efficiency and Sustainability
Given that the fridge is the only home appliance in your house that never sleeps, its energy effectiveness rating is essential to your long-term energy expenses.
Key things to search for:
- ENERGY STAR ® Certification: Units with this label meet strict energy effectiveness specs set by the EPA.
- Inverter Compressors: These run at a variable speed instead of switching on and off, which substantially lowers energy usage and sound levels.
- LED Lighting: LED lights release less heat than standard bulbs, implying the Fridge For Sale does not need to work as tough to maintain its internal temperature level.
5. Maintenance Tips for Longevity
Investing in a quality fridge is only half the fight; how you treat it identifies its life-span.
- Keep the Coils Clean: Dust accumulation on the condenser coils forces the motor to work more difficult. Vacuum these coils every 6 to 12 months.
- Examine the Door Seals: If the rubber gaskets around your doors become brittle or loose, cold air will get away. Test this by closing a piece of paper in the door-- if it moves out quickly, it's time to replace the seal.
- Don't Overstuff: Fridges need air blood circulation to stay cool. Overcrowding the fridge requires the compressor to run continuously.

Q: Should I purchase a counter-depth or standard-depth fridge?A: A counter-depth fridge sits flush with your cabinets for a sleek, built-in look. Nevertheless, they are usually more pricey and offer less interior storage space. Choose standard-depth if you need optimal capability and aren't concerned about the "integrated" appearance.
Q: How long should I wait to plug in a new fridge?A: If the fridge was transported on its side or back, you ought to wait a minimum of 12-- 24 hours before plugging it in to allow the compressor oil to settle. Even if moved upright, it is normally finest practice to wait 2-- 4 hours.
